First Research Published Using Cleveland Clinic’s COVID-19 Study Samples Provides Glimpse into Potential New Treatments

Dr. Jung and his team of researchers published the novel COVID-19 study, which details the critical role viral gene ORF8 plays in infection and outcomes rates, using samples from Cleveland Clinic’s BioRepository.

A research team led by Jae Jung, PhD, Director of the Global Center for Pathogen & Human Health Research, has uncovered the critical role a viral gene, ORF8, plays in infection and disease outcomes of Severe Acute Respiratory Syndrome Coronavirus 2 (SARS-CoV-2). The study, published in mBio, provides a greater understanding of molecular mechanisms that can accelerate immune cell activation and could suggest treatments for patients with COVID-19. This is the first published study using samples from the COVID-19 registry of the Cleveland Clinic BioRepository.

New findings reveal ORF8 worsens inflammation

While previous studies have shown that those with severe cases of COVID-19 often develop signs of acute respiratory distress syndrome (ARDS), many basic aspects of the SARS-CoV-2 virus remain unknown.

According to the new findings by Dr. Jung and his team, SARS-CoV-2 Open reading frame 8 (ORF8), a viral inflammatory protein, contributes to the severity and spread of COVID-19.

“Our team studied the triggers for cytokine meditated inflammation and identified the ORF8 as a stand out viral gene showing its mutations that were related to the virus’s ability to inflame and spread,” said Dr. Jung.

“We knew patients infected with SARS-CoV-2 variants that lacked ORF8 were associated with milder infection outcomes,” said Dr. Xin Wu, a postdoctoral fellow in Dr. Jung’s lab who led this study.  The study revealed that SARS-CoV-2 ORF8 is a viral mimic of another inflammatory protein that contributes to severe inflammation.

“The resources and COVID-19 samples provided by the BioRepository were essential in understanding the relationship between plasma ORF8 levels of SARS-COV-2 and COVID-19 disease outcomes,” said Dr. Wu. “In this case, understanding the role of ORF8 can lead to new treatments that could provide benefits for patients with severe COVID-19.”
